As an expert in c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T) for anxiety, mood, and obsessive-compulsive and related disorders, I use evidence-based practice for conditions such as ob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D), hoarding, trichotillomania (hairpulling), panic disorder, phobias, social anxiety, generalized anxiety, depression, and posttraumatic stress disorder (PTSD). I am board certified in clinical psychology, and have two decades of experience treating clients. I am the recipient of the Award for Distinguished Lifetime Contribution to Psychology from the Connecticut Psychological Association.
I am an active clinician/researcher, working with the National Institute of Mental Health. I am Past-President of the Association for Behavioral and Cognitive Therapies, and Past-President of the Clinical Psychology Division of the American Psychological Association. I am an Adjunct Professor at Yale School of Medicine.
I am the author of several books such as "The Big Book of Exposures," "Doing CBT," "Buried in Treasures," "Treating Trichotillomania," "Face Your Fears," and "CBT for Hoarding Disorder." I have been featured on the TV series "The OCD Project," "Hoarders," and "The Oprah Winfrey Show."
